Understanding the Causes of Stinky Toms

Before we dive into the solutions, it’s essential to understand why Toms can become smelly in the first place. The primary cause of foot odor is the growth of bacteria and fungi on the feet and in the shoes. When your feet sweat, they create a warm, moist environment that’s perfect for these microorganisms to thrive. Foot Hygiene and Shoe Maintenance

Poor foot hygiene and inadequate shoe maintenance can exacerbate the problem of smelly Toms. Failing to wash your feet regularly, not drying them properly, and wearing the same shoes every day can create an ideal environment for bacteria and fungi to grow. Additionally, not cleaning and drying your Toms regularly can lead to the accumulation of sweat, dirt, and debris, which can further contribute to the growth of microorganisms.

Materials and Design

The materials and design of your Toms can also play a role in odor accumulation. Shoes made from synthetic materials, such as plastic and nylon, can be more prone to odor buildup than those made from natural materials, like cotton and canvas. Furthermore, Toms with poor ventilation and drainage can trap moisture, creating an ideal environment for bacteria and fungi to thrive.

Natural Remedies

There are several natural remedies that can help eliminate odors from your Toms. Baking soda, vinegar, and tea tree oil are all effective at neutralizing odors and preventing the growth of bacteria and fungi. You can try sprinkling baking soda inside your Toms, letting them sit overnight, and then shaking out the excess in the morning. Alternatively, you can mix equal parts water and vinegar in a spray bottle and spray the solution inside your Toms. For a more potent solution, you can add a few drops of tea tree oil to the vinegar mixture.

Washing and Drying Toms

In some cases, washing and drying your Toms may be necessary to eliminate odors. Check the care label on your Toms to see if they can be machine washed or if they require hand washing. If you can machine wash your Toms, use a mild detergent and cold water. Avoid using hot water or harsh chemicals, as they can damage the materials or cause discoloration. After washing, make sure to dry your Toms thoroughly, either by air drying them or using a fan to speed up the process.

What are some effective ways to eliminate odors from Toms shoes?

There are several effective ways to eliminate odors from Toms shoes, including using baking soda, essential oils, and odor-eliminating sprays. Baking soda is a natural odor absorber and can be used to eliminate foot odor from Toms shoes by sprinkling a small amount of powder inside the shoes and letting them sit overnight. Essential oils, such as tea tree oil or lavender oil, also have natural antibacterial and antifungal properties and can be used to eliminate odor-causing microorganisms from the shoes.

To use essential oils to eliminate odors from Toms shoes, simply add a few drops of the oil to a spray bottle filled with water, shake the bottle well, and spray the mixture inside the shoes. Let the shoes sit for a few hours or overnight to allow the oil to work its way into the materials and eliminate any odor-causing microorganisms. Odor-eliminating sprays can also be used to eliminate foot odor from Toms shoes, and are often available at shoe stores or online. These sprays work by killing the bacteria and fungi that cause foot odor, leaving the shoes smelling fresh and clean.

Can I use household items to eliminate odors from my Toms shoes?

Yes, there are several household items that can be used to eliminate odors from Toms shoes, including vinegar, lemon juice, and activated charcoal. Vinegar is a natural acid that can help to break down and eliminate odor-causing compounds, and can be used to eliminate foot odor from Toms shoes by mixing equal parts water and vinegar in a spray bottle and spraying the mixture inside the shoes. Lemon juice also has natural antibacterial and antifungal properties and can be used to eliminate odor-causing microorganisms from the shoes.

To use lemon juice to eliminate odors from Toms shoes, simply squeeze a few drops of the juice onto a cloth or paper towel and rub it inside the shoes. Let the shoes sit for a few hours or overnight to allow the lemon juice to work its way into the materials and eliminate any odor-causing microorganisms. Activated charcoal can also be used to eliminate foot odor from Toms shoes, and works by absorbing the odor-causing compounds and eliminating them from the shoes. Simply place a small amount of activated charcoal inside the shoes and let them sit overnight, then remove the charcoal and discard it.

How often should I wash my Toms shoes to prevent foot odor?

The frequency at which you should wash your Toms shoes to prevent foot odor depends on how often you wear them and under what conditions. If you wear your Toms shoes daily, it is a good idea to wash them at least once a week to prevent the buildup of sweat and bacteria. However, if you only wear your Toms shoes occasionally, you may only need to wash them every few months. It is also important to consider the type of materials used in your Toms shoes, as some materials may require more frequent washing than others.

To wash your Toms shoes, start by checking the care label to see if they can be machine washed. If they can be machine washed, use a mild detergent and cold water to prevent damage to the materials. If the shoes cannot be machine washed, you can wash them by hand using a mild soap and cold water. Be sure to av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ials, as these can damage the shoes and cause them to wear out more quickly. After washing your Toms shoes, allow them to air dry to prevent the growth of bacteria and fungi that can cause foot odor.
